Jones, NKU rout North Florida 72-45

HIGHLAND HEIGHTS, Ky. (AP) - Eshaunte Jones scored 30 points to eclipse 1,000 career points as Northern Kentucky routed North Florida 72-45 Thursday night to sweep the season series.
   
The Norse (10-15, 8-9 Atlantic Sun Conference), who came in having lost four of their previous five games, led 34-26 at the break. Ethan Faulkner's 3-pointer to open the second half sparked a 21-4 run.
   
Jones was 10-of-15 shooting and made 6 of 9 3-pointers as Northern Kentucky went 11 of 19 from deep.
   
The Norse outshot the Ospreys 58.3 percent (14 of 24) to 31.8 percent (7 of 22) in the second half.
   
Northern Kentucky scored 23 points off 14 North Florida turnovers, while giving up four points on three miscues.
   
Tyler White added 12 points for the Norse, who also defeated North Florida 65-52 on Jan. 2.
   
Charles McRoy's 13 points off the bench led the Ospreys (12-18, 7-10), whose two-game winning streak ended.
